The brief but brilliant career of Melissa Mathison offers a vivid case study of an artist who succeeded in maximizing the benefits of each opportunity she was afforded. Though she had only a half dozen films to her credit when she passed away last year from complications of neuroendocrine cancer at the age of 65, Mathison earned a permanent place in American pop culture as the screenwriter of "E.T. the Extra-Terrestrial" in 1982.
